More to see in Budva
Budva is an ancient city with rich history. Simply every attraction here is connected with many interesting stories and legends. While walking through the picturesque narrow streets of the city, visitors will surely see old churches, beautiful squares and gorgeous mansions that never cease to surprise visitors with their luxury. Among the religious attractions of the city we simply cannot fail to recommend visiting the ruins of the ancient basilica built in the 5th century. Despite the fact that the building has been almost completely destroyed, its territory still keeps skillful mosaic, the age of which is more than a thousand and a half years. Santa Maria Church belongs to later religious monuments. The construction of the church took place in the 9th century. The church’s walls are home to several unique religious artifacts, and the interior of the building is decorated with subtle hand-painted murals and antique frescoes. The Churches of St. Stephen and Holy Trinity remains the most striking architectural monument of the Middle Ages. They are located just a few steps away from each other, but the churches are built in different architectural styles. The architectural ensemble looks very harmonious and efficiently demonstrates rapid development of architectural styles. The Citadel remains one of the main symbols of the city. Shopping, streets and outlets

For unusual souvenirs go to the embankment of Budva, where an excellent flea market operates. Walking along its colorful shopping tents, you can find a lot of interesting antiquities. The market offers old paintings and statuettes, antique dishes and even items of antique furniture. Many come here to choose beautiful vintage photo frames.
